For enhanced safety, the front and rear seat shoulder belts of the Subaru Outback have pretensioners to tighten the seatbelts and eliminate dangerous slack in the event of a collision and force limiters to limit the pressure the belts will exert on the passengers. The Chevrolet Trax doesn’t offer pretensioners for its rear seat belts.
For enhanced safety, the front seat shoulder belts of the Subaru Outback are height-adjustable to accommodate a wide variety of driver and passenger heights. A better fit can prevent injuries and the increased comfort also encourages passengers to buckle up. The Chevrolet Trax doesn’t offer height-adjustable seat belts.
The Subaru Outback has a standard driver’s side knee airbag mounted low on the dashboard. The knee airbag helps prevent the driver from sliding under the seatbelts or the main frontal airbag; this keeps the driver better positioned during a collision for maximum protection. A knee airbag also helps keep the legs from striking the dashboard, preventing knee and leg injuries in the case of a serious frontal collision. The Trax doesn’t offer knee airbags.
The Outback has standard Whiplash-Reducing Front Seats, which use a specially designed seat to protect the driver and front passenger from whiplash. During a rear-end collision, the Whiplash-Reducing Front Seats system allows the backrest to travel backwards to cushion the occupants and the headrests move forward to prevent neck and spine injuries. The Trax doesn’t offer a whiplash protection system.
Over 200 people are killed each year when backed over by motor vehicles. The Outback has standard Reverse Automatic Braking that use rear sensors to monitor for objects to the rear and automatically apply the brakes to prevent a collision. The Trax doesn’t offer backup collision prevention brakes.
The Outback has all-wheel drive to maximize traction under poor conditions, especially in ice and snow. The Trax doesn’t offer all-wheel drive.
When descending a steep, off-road slope, the Outback’s standard Hill Descent Control allows you to creep down safely. The Trax doesn’t offer Hill Descent Control.
The Outback (except Premium/Limited 2.5) offers an optional 360-Degree Surround View Monitor to allow the driver to see objects all around the vehicle on a screen. The Trax only offers a rear monitor and rear parking sensors that beep or flash a light. That doesn’t help with obstacles to the front or sides.
The Subaru Outback’s rear backup camera has a standard washer for maintaining a clear view under various conditions. In contrast, the Chevrolet Trax does not offer a rear camera washer, meaning its effectiveness relies on manual cleaning by the user when necessary.
The Outback has a standard blind spot warning system that uses sensors to alert the driver to objects in the vehicle’s blind spots where the side view mirrors don’t reveal them. A system to reveal vehicles in the Trax’s blind spot costs extra.
To help make backing out of a parking space safer, the Outback has standard Rear Cross Traffic Alert, helping the driver avoid collisions. Chevrolet charges extra for Rear Cross Traffic Alert on the Trax.
The Outback’s driver alert monitor detects an inattentive driver then sounds a warning and suggests a break. According to the NHTSA, drivers who fall asleep cause about 100,000 crashes and 1500 deaths a year. The Trax doesn’t offer a driver alert monitor.
Both the Outback and the Trax have standard driver and passenger frontal airbags, front side-impact airbags, side-impact head airbags, four-wheel antilock brakes, traction control, electronic stability systems to prevent skidding, crash mitigating brakes, daytime running lights, lane departure warning systems and rearview cameras.
The Subaru Outback weighs 705 to 999 pounds more than the Chevrolet Trax. The NHTSA advises that heavier cars are much safer in collisions than their significantly lighter counterparts. Crosswinds also affect lighter cars more.
